charles抓包看回传地址
时间: 2025-01-07 08:50:27 浏览: 11
### 使用Charles代理工具抓取HTTP请求并检查响应中的URL
#### 配置设备连接至Charles代理
确保目标设备(如智能手机或计算机)设置为通过Charles所在的机器进行网络流量转发。这通常涉及配置Wi-Fi设置中的HTTP代理指向运行Charles的主机IP地址以及指定端口(默认8888)。[^2]
#### 安装SSL证书以便HTTPS抓包
由于现代应用多采用HTTPS协议传输数据,为了使Charles能成功拦截并解析这些加密通信的内容,需先安装由Charles自动生成的信任根证书到客户端装置上。此操作允许Charles作为中间人解密来自应用程序和服务端之间的对话而不引发安全警告。
#### 开始监控与过滤特定流量
一旦上述准备工作完成,在Charles主界面上会实时显示所有经过其路由发出或接收的信息流列表;此时可通过左侧站点结构树快速定位感兴趣的资源项——比如按照域名分组展示出来的各个网页元素加载记录。
针对具体要分析的应用程序产生的网络活动,则建议运用顶部菜单栏提供的“Recording Settings”选项来设定仅捕捉该进程关联的数据交换事件,减少无关干扰的同时提高效率。[^1]
#### 查看和筛选响应详情
点击任意一项已捕获的历史条目即可展开右侧详细面板,这里不仅能看到完整的Request Headers/Body部分,更重要的是Response标签页内包含了服务器返回给客户端的确切路径链接等重要情报。借助内置搜索框可迅速锁定含有特殊关键词的目标对象,方便后续深入研究。[^4]
```bash
# 设置 Charles 的 SSL 代理功能以支持 HTTPS 抓包
Proxy -> Proxy Settings... -> SSL -> Enable SSL proxying
```
阅读全文